Angel Number 111: Biblical Meaning Revealed

what does 111 mean biblically

Angel Number 111: Biblical Meaning Revealed

The interpretation of numerical sequences within a biblical context is a complex subject. While the Bible contains instances of symbolic number usage, attributing specific, fixed meanings to repeating number patterns like “111” is largely absent from direct scriptural texts. The presence of repeated numbers is more often associated with modern numerology and New Age beliefs, which draw upon varied sources beyond traditional biblical interpretation.

Despite the absence of explicit biblical definition, some interpret repeated ones as a sign of unity with God or Christ, reflecting the singularity of God’s nature as described in Deuteronomy 6:4: “Hear, O Israel: The Lord our God, the Lord is one.” Others view it as a call to strengthen one’s faith, a reminder of God’s constant presence, or a sign to pay attention to one’s thoughts and align them with divine will. The importance lies in the individual’s subjective experience and their personal connection to faith and spirituality.

7+ Facts: What Does Rainbow Trout Taste Like?

what does rainbow trout taste like

7+ Facts: What Does Rainbow Trout Taste Like?

The flavor profile of this freshwater fish is generally mild and delicate. Its taste is often described as slightly nutty, with a subtle earthiness that is not overpowering. The flesh tends to be tender and flaky, contributing to a pleasant eating experience. The adjective “taste” describes a sensory experience of flavor.

The subtle nature of its flavor makes it a versatile culinary ingredient. Its mildness allows it to pair well with a wide range of seasonings and cooking methods. From simple preparations like grilling with lemon and herbs to more elaborate dishes, its delicate flavor is easily complemented without being masked. Historically, this fish has been a staple in various cultures, prized for its palatable taste and nutritional value.

DWT on a Scale: What Does It Mean? Guide

what does dwt mean on a scale

DWT on a Scale: What Does It Mean? Guide

DWT, when displayed on a weighing instrument, signifies pennyweight. A pennyweight is a unit of mass equal to 1/20 of a troy ounce, or approximately 1.555 grams. For example, if a scale shows a reading of “10 DWT,” it indicates the item weighs ten pennyweights.

The usage of pennyweight as a measurement unit is primarily found in the precious metals and gemstone industries. This system offers a convenient and precise means of expressing the weight of small, valuable items. Historically, the term relates to the weight of a silver penny in medieval England, providing context to its continued use in measuring precious materials.

8+ Fragrant Ways: What Does Agarwood Smell Like?

what does agarwood smell like

8+ Fragrant Ways: What Does Agarwood Smell Like?

The aromatic profile of agarwood is complex and highly prized. It presents a multifaceted scent, often described as a blend of woody, balsamic, and sweet notes. Depending on the origin, resin content, and distillation process, nuances of leather, spice, fruit, and even animalic facets can be perceived. These diverse characteristics contribute to its allure and make its fragrance a sought-after element in perfumery and incense production.

The desirability of agarwood stems from its long-lasting aroma and its perceived spiritual and medicinal properties. Historically, it has been used in religious ceremonies across various cultures and valued for its calming and grounding effects. Furthermore, the unique fragrance profile makes it a key ingredient in high-end perfumes, adding depth and complexity that other ingredients cannot replicate, thus elevating the perceived value and sophistication of the final product. The cost is often substantial due to the relative rarity of high-quality resinous wood.
